Response Line Navigator
Be the first voice a survivor hears. Response Line Navigators are trained volunteers who answer our response line, gather information with care, and connect survivors to their next step toward safety.
Volunteering With Us: FAQs
How can I volunteer with Safe House Project?
You can volunteer by becoming an Ambassador, hosting a fundraiser, or partnering with us as a corporation. Each role directly supports survivors of trafficking and contributes to our mission to eradicate domestic human trafficking.
Why does volunteering matter in the fight against human trafficking?
Volunteers help raise awareness, support survivors, and drive policy change. Your time can create a ripple effect that helps end this crime and restore hope to survivors.
What impact does volunteering with Safe House Project have?
When you volunteer, you directly support our efforts to provide safe housing, holistic care, and educational opportunities for survivors of trafficking, helping us expand our reach and strengthen our mission.
How can my company get involved through corporate volunteering?
Companies can get involved by providing financial support, in-kind donations, or encouraging employees to volunteer directly. These partnerships are crucial in expanding our survivor services and spreading awareness on a larger scale.
